How much do frontend software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for frontend software engineer in Arizona is $129,469.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$105,300.00 and $150,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Frontend Software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Frontend Software Engineer, you need strong proficiency in H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and modern frontend frameworks like React or Angular, typically supported by a degree in computer science or related experience. Familiarity with version control systems (such as Git), responsive design tools, and build tools like Webpack or npm is also important. Creativity, problem-solving, and effective communication help engineers collaborate with teams and deliver user-friendly interfaces. These skills are crucial for building performant, maintainable, and visually appealing applications that meet user needs and business goals.

What are some common challenges faced by Frontend Software Engineers when working on cross-functional teams?

Frontend Software Engineers often collaborate closely with backend developers, designers, and product managers. A common challenge is ensuring effective communication and alignment, especially when translating design mockups into functional user interfaces or integrating with backend APIs. Balancing user experience goals with technical constraints and timelines can also be demanding. Proactively participating in sprint planning and code reviews helps foster collaboration and ensures smoother project delivery.

What does a Frontend Software Engineer do?

A Frontend Software Engineer is responsible for designing and implementing the user interface of websites and web applications. They work with technologies like H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, as well as frameworks such as React or Angular, to create interactive and visually appealing experiences for users. Their job also involves ensuring that websites are responsive, accessible, and optimized for performance across various devices and browsers. Collaboration with designers, backend engineers, and other team members is a key part of their role.

What is the difference between Frontend Software Engineer vs Web Developer?

AspectFrontend Software EngineerWeb Developer
Required skillsHTML, CSS, JavaScript, frameworks (React, Angular), UI/UX principlesHTML, CSS, JavaScript, basic backend knowledge
Work environmentCollaborates with designers, backend developers, product teamsBuilds websites, often with less focus on complex UI/UX
Industry usageTech companies, startups, agenciesSmall businesses, freelance projects, agencies

Frontend Software Engineers focus on creating interactive, user-friendly interfaces using advanced frameworks and UI principles, often working closely with designers and backend teams. Web Developers may handle broader website development tasks, including basic front-end and some backend work, with less emphasis on complex UI design. Both roles are essential in web development but differ in scope and specialization.
